Buying Guide
When choosing pantry organizers for real-life cleanups, focus on fit, adjustability and visibility. Measure shelf or drawer depth before you buy—the wrong width is the most common mismatch creators warn about. Look for adjustable dividers or removable inserts so the organizer adapts to different container sizes. Clear materials help you identify contents quickly, while natural materials like bamboo reduce visual clutter on open shelves. Consider stackability and how a piece interfaces with other organizers; modular bins or tiers let you build vertical storage without sacrificing access. Finally, think about cleaning: plastic bins wipe clean, while wood needs occasional oiling and careful drying. If you plan to use organizers for heavy items, prioritize sturdier builds or reinforced edges.
